Cleanest profile; no telemetry/CVEs; Postgres extension
- Open source: yes (PostgreSQL License)
- Self-hostable: yes
- Pricing model: free
- Best for: Database developers and engineers who need to store and query vector embeddings alongside relational data in Postgres.
- Last verified: 2026-09-04
Is pgvector open source?
Yes — PostgreSQL License-licensed.
How much does pgvector cost?
It is free to use.
Can I self-host pgvector?
Yes — it can be self-hosted.
